
How to remove mosaics and restore photos?
The mosaic on the photo cannot be restored. Mosaic refers to a widely used image processing method. This method degrades the color details of specific areas of the image and causes the effect of disrupted color blocks. , the function of this mosaic is to destroy the details of the image behind it, which is irreversible.
Mosaic
The application of mosaic originated in ancient Greece. At first, due to technical reasons and other reasons, black and white were simply used for combinations. This was very popular among the ruling class at that time because it had good visual effects. Later, in order to enrich the works in a more diversified way, some people tried Start using smaller pieces of gravel, or cut your own small stones to complete a mosaic.
Hundreds of years later, mosaics gradually became very common, and the floors and walls of ordinary houses and public buildings also began to be decorated with them. Especially in the Roman period, Rome's prosperous and affluent social economy made mosaics The application of tiles has achieved unprecedented development, which also made ancient Roman architecture very luxurious.
Of course, the golden age of mosaic developed with the development of Christianity. In the early days of Christianity, a large number of believers were persecuted because they were not recognized, so they poured into basements in large numbers to avoid gatherings because they were illiterate. , so they described the story of Christ Jesus through mosaics.
In the Byzantine Empire, Emperor Constantine made Christianity legal and vigorously promoted its development, so a large number of churches began to use mosaics to beautify them, and the colors used became more and more abundant, and there were even a lot of gold foil. It was also used in it. This was the peak period of the development of mosaic.
On October 20, 2016, Palestine announced that it would launch a protection project for the giant mosaic floor of the historical site. The repaired mosaic floor is expected to be available to tourists by the end of 2018. This mosaic floor is located in the ruins of Hisham's palace north of Jericho and dates back nearly 1,300 years. The entire ground is composed of 38 colorful mosaic patterns, with a total area of 827 square meters, which is rare in the world.
